1. The Science of Degradation: How Heat Kills Batteries

In the world of electrochemistry, heat is an accelerant. According to the Arrhenius Law, the rate of chemical reactions generally doubles with every 10°C increase in temperature. In the Middle East, where ambient temperatures are consistently high, standard batteries face three primary threats:

Electrolyte Evaporation: In conventional piles zinc-carbone ou piles alcalines, high heat causes the moisture in the electrolyte to evaporate or the chemical balance to shift, leading to leakage or premature drying.

Internal Resistance Spikes: Excessive heat increases the internal resistance of the cell, meaning the battery has to work harder to deliver the same amount of energy, leading to a “death spiral” of efficiency loss.

Self-Discharge Acceleration: High temperatures significantly speed up the rate at which a battery loses its charge while sitting on a shelf, reducing the effective shelf life for retailers and distributors in countries like Saudi Arabia, the UAE, and Qatar.

2. Industry-Specific Challenges in the Gulf Region

The Middle East market isn’t just about consumer gadgets; it’s an industrial powerhouse. The need for reliable industrial battery supplies spans several sectors:

A. Smart Metering and Infrastructure

Saudi Arabia’s Vision 2030 and the UAE’s “Net Zero by 2050” initiative involve massive rollouts of smart water and gas meters. These devices are often located outdoors in direct sunlight. If the battery fails due to heat, the entire infrastructure grid loses data.

B. Security and Remote Monitoring

Oil and gas pipelines in the desert rely on remote sensors and GPS tracking. Shandong Huatai’s heavy-duty batteries are engineered to provide consistent voltage output even when encased in metal housing units that can reach internal temperatures of 70°C.

C. Professional Lighting and Outdoor Tools

From construction sites in NEOM to desert tourism, high-intensity flashlights and professional tools require long-lasting alkaline batteries that won’t leak or swell under the desert sun.

FAQ: Batteries in High-Temperature Markets

Q: What is the ideal storage temperature for batteries in the Middle East? A: While batteries are best stored at 15°C to 25°C, Huatai’s FLASH D'ALIMENTATION series is designed to withstand storage up to 45°C for extended periods without significant capacity loss, provided they are kept in a dry, ventilated area.

Q: Can high heat cause batteries to leak? A: Yes. Heat causes the internal materials to expand. Huatai’s Canadian HIBAR-line alkaline batteries feature a reinforced sealing structure and an anti-explosion vent to prevent leakage even if the internal pressure rises due to heat.

Q: Are alkaline or zinc-carbon batteries better for the Middle East? A: For high-drain devices or outdoor equipment, Alkaline batteries (LR6/LR03) are superior due to their higher energy density and better thermal stability. For low-drain devices like remote controls, Huatai Super Heavy Duty (Zinc Carbon) batteries offer a cost-effective solution.
